The circumference of a circle is the distance around its perimeter and equals π (approx. 3.14159) x diameter: c = π d. The area of a circle is π x (radius)2 : a = π r2.
Simplify (7a)(8ab) + (4a2)(5b).
| 76a2b | |
| -36a2b | |
| 135a2b | |
| 36ab2 |
To multiply monomials, multiply the coefficients (the numbers that come before the variables) of each term, add the exponents of like variables, and multiply the different variables together.
(7a)(8ab) + (4a2)(5b)
(7 x 8)(a x a x b) + (4 x 5)(a2 x b)
(56)(a1+1 x b) + (20)(a2b)
56a2b + 20a2b
76a2b

A line segment is a portion of a line with a measurable length. The midpoint of a line segment is the point exactly halfway between the endpoints. The midpoint bisects (cuts in half) the line segment.
What is the circumference of a circle with a radius of 10?
| 20π | |
| 10π | |
| 3π | |
| 24π |
The formula for circumference is circle diameter x π. Circle diameter is 2 x radius:
c = πd
c = π(2 * r)
c = π(2 * 10)
c = 20π
Solve for z:
-9z - 2 = -4 + 5z
| \(\frac{1}{2}\) | |
| \(\frac{1}{7}\) | |
| 9 | |
| -1\(\frac{1}{8}\) |
To solve this equation, repeatedly do the same thing to both sides of the equation until the variable is isolated on one side of the equal sign and the answer on the other.
-9z - 2 = -4 + 5z
-9z = -4 + 5z + 2
-9z - 5z = -4 + 2
-14z = -2
z = \( \frac{-2}{-14} \)
z = \(\frac{1}{7}\)
